LIGHTNING: a hazard to model fliers? In the May 1988 issue I briefly discussed the potential hazard of lightning striking a model flier when a thunderstorm is approaching. I asked if any readers knew of an incident in which a model flier had been the victim of a lightning strike. In response I received four letters, and one (from John Shaud, West Hempstead, NY) did cite an incident that John had come close to witnessing some 30 years ago at a Control Line flying site in Forest Park, Queens, NY. However, the incident that John recalls did not occur while flying activities were taking place. He had been flying at the park when an approaching thunderstorm darkened the sky and caused him to terminate his flying activities and go home. Later that evening he heard a news broadcast that a group of CL fliers, average age about 14 years, who also had been flying in the park, had not left when the storm approached, but had taken shelter from the rain under a huge oak tree. When lightning struck the tree, three of the boys were killed, and four were severely burned.

STRUCTURAL FAILURE: Airplanes, both full-scale and models, require that certain vital parts have sufficient strength to withstand the stresses that they will be subjected to during flight. Full-scale aircraft designers go through a lot of calculations, and conduct extensive testing to ensure that the end product will perform in the intended manner without falling apart in the air. But what about those who design model aircraft that are to be sold to the general public in the form of a kit? Do the companies that produce these kits do any calculations or perform any tests to determine the necessary size of a wing spar or thickness of a sheet-balsa stabilizer to prevent breakage during high-G maneuvers such as the corners of a square loop? I don't have an answer to this question, and even if kit manufacturers do satisfy themselves that their products have adequate strength, who is to say that you, the purchaser of the kit, are going to do a sufficiently good job in building the model to prevent it from falling apart in the air?

SAFETY CAMPAIGN. A couple of weeks ago I received a letter from Martin Dilly, the public relations officer for the Society of Model Aeronautical Engineers (SMAE)-the British counterpart of AMA. In a manner similar to the AMA plan, the SMAE provides its members with insurance coverage. Martin's letter stated that during the last three years they had received 81 claims on their policy, and they had two fatalities in 1987 which were attributed to model flying activities. (I reported on one of these-the collision between a hang glider and an RC Sailplane-in my February 1988 column.) As a consequence of the accidents, the SMAE has launched a major safety campaign which focuses on RC Power fliers.
